. Diseases of the horse's foot. Horses; Hoofs -- Diseases; Horses -- Diseases. DISEASES FROM FAULTY CONFORMATION 179 ful a method of dealing with sand-crack as has yet been devised. It may be done in a variety of ways : (1) By two grooves arranged about the crack in the form of a V, as Fig. 94; (2) by a perpendicular groove on either side of the crack, about 1 inch in distance from it, and parallel with the horn fibres, as Fig. 95 ; (3) by a single horizontal groove at the extreme upper limit of the crack; (4) by drawing two horizontal grooves, one at its upper and one at its lower end (see Fig. 96)..
